The dataset supports research of a proprietary methanolic Boerhavia diffusa crude extract, examined for its inherent cytotoxicity and neuroprotection against 6-hydroxydopamine (6-OHDA)-induced damage in neuroblastoma SH-SY5Y cell line, assessed using the sulforhodamine B (SRB) assay. Antioxidant activity was determined using the 2,2-diphenyl-1-picrylhydrazyl (DPPH) and ferric reducing antioxidant power (FRAP) assays. Monoamine oxidase (MAO) inhibition was assessed using the Amplex Red™ monoamine oxidase assay kit.
